Output e32cae7f7aea5e021268dd766d712667e6ac84f81137cbf5d027c8e574a7791a:1

value
28844543
script pubkey
OP_0 OP_PUSHBYTES_32 f258cb74576d1f3bcb2d3b8f6c0d9afd9e6eeae47fa4787f59d1f6c641444868
address
bc1q7fvvkazhd50nhjed8w8kcrv6lk0xa6hy07j8sl6e68mvvs2yfp5q95hkzu
transaction
e32cae7f7aea5e021268dd766d712667e6ac84f81137cbf5d027c8e574a7791a